Output 667c6d8a5c8b161cc905659d25c8953df816f1f4dfdce14e95ceeed1b93d0103:0

value
576497
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b3d82dce0fea897fc2e726b4bc49ebfd853d08e OP_EQUALVERIFY OP_CHECKSIG
address
14wdk7zm2yPaJXZUuvMtZjotxoidZnkk3e
transaction
667c6d8a5c8b161cc905659d25c8953df816f1f4dfdce14e95ceeed1b93d0103
confirmations
2394
spent
true